Member-only story
Mastering BERT: A Comprehensive Guide from Beginner to Advanced in Natural Language Processing (NLP)
19 min readSep 13, 2023
Google Bert
Introduction:
BERT (Bidirectional Encoder Representations from Transformers) is a revolutionary natural language processing (NLP) model developed by Google. It has transformed the landscape of language understanding tasks, enabling machines to comprehend context and nuances in language. In this blog, we’ll take you on a journey from the basics to advanced concepts of BERT, complete with explanations, examples, and code snippets.
Table of Contents
- Introduction to BERT
- What is BERT?
- Why is BERT Important?
- How does BERT work?
2. Preprocessing Text for BERT
- Tokenization
- Input Formatting
- Masked Language Model (MLM) Objective
3. Fine-Tuning BERT for Specific Tasks
- BERT’s Architecture Variations (BERT-base, BERT-large, etc.)
- Transfer Learning in NLP
- Downstream Tasks and Fine-Tuning
- Example: Text Classification with BERT